Solicitation No. 70Z03026QCLEV0046 Provide all labor, material, equipment, transportation, and supervision required for USCG NINTH DISTRICT TEMPORARY LODGING FOR RESERVE MEMBERS IAW the Statement of Work. Refer to the Statement of Work for requirements. The estimated range of this procurement is between $100K and $250K. The applicable NAICS is 721110 Hotels (except Casino Hotels) and Motels with a Small Business Size Standard of $44.0M. Background The U.S. Coast Guard (USCG) is seeking to procure temporary lodging for Reserve members of the Great Lakes District during their Inactive Duty Training (IDT). This contract aims to provide necessary accommodations to support the training and operational readiness of reserve personnel. The estimated value of this procurement is between $100,000 and $250,000, with a focus on ensuring compliance with the Statement of Work requirements. Work Details The contractor will be responsible for providing all labor, materials, equipment, transportation, and supervision necessary for the temporary lodging of USCG Reserve personnel. Key tasks include: 1. Providing double occupancy rooms for approximately 55 to 115 reserve members each month during IDT drills. 2. Ensuring that room assignments separate members by officer/enlisted status, gender, and rank. 3. Charging the Coast Guard based on actual room usage calculated monthly (e.g., 5 rooms for 4 nights at $125/night equals $2,500). 4. Coordinating with the Coast Guard through multiple points of contact to resolve any emergent issues related to lodging. 5. Adhering to GSA Per Diem rates for nightly room charges based on seasonal and locality factors. 6. Receiving and processing monthly manifests from the Coast Guard detailing reservations and confirmations by the 15th of each month prior to lodging needs. 7. Handling late requests on a case-by-case basis while providing a cancellation window of three business days prior to check-in dates. 8. Submitting weekly reports on 'no shows' and providing consolidated invoices detailing hotel names, member names, nights stayed, prices per night, total amounts charged, and check-in sheets. Period of Performance The contract will be performed from June 1, 2026, to May 31, 2027. Place of Performance Cleveland, OH
